Download as pdf or txt
Download as pdf or txt
You are on page 1of 5

FAKULTET ELEKTROTEHNIKE KOMUNIKACIJE

ZADACA 1
Statisticka teorija telekomunikacija
Rudi Peric III-21/07

April 2012

1. a) Napisati Octave program koji simulira utrku konja, u kojoj ucestvuje 12 konja. Trifecta je izraz koji oznacava opkladu na tacan poredak tj. koja ce tri konja zauzeti prva tri mjesta pri cemu je bitan redoslijed. Sa velikim brojem simulacija u Octave-u prikazati vrijednost estimacije vjerovatnoce da se dobije trifecta. Uporediti estimaciju vjerovatnoce sa analiticki dobijenom vjerovatnocom. Obrazloiti. b) Trifecta box se odnosi na opkladu pri cemu igrac bira 3 konja koja ce zauzeti prvo, drugo i trece mjesto ali sada nije bitan redoslijed. Ponoviti analizu pod a) za Trifecta box.

Rijesenje analiticki :

k=12 n=3

-ukupan broj konja -broj koji se bira

a) -Vjerovatnoca pogotka prvog je P(p)=

12 1

- Vjerovatnoca pogotka drugog je P(d)= - Vjerovatnoca pogotka treceg je P(t)=

11

10

Ukupna vjerovatnoca je : P(a)= P(p) * P(d) * P(t) = 12 * 11 * 10 = 1320 = 0.0007575


1 1 1 1

b) -broj kombinacija kada nam nije bitan poredak ! = ! !


12 3 12! 3!(123)!

n=

=220

P(b) =

1 n

= 0.004545

Rijesenje programski :

clear all close all clc N=100000; poredak = [5 2 6]; trifecta=0; trifecta_box=0; for k=1:N; utrka=randperm(12); if (poredak(1)==utrka(1) && poredak(2)==utrka(2) && poredak(3)==utrka(3)) trifecta = trifecta + 1; end if ((utrka(1)==poredak(1)||utrka(2)==poredak(1)||utrka(3)==poredak(1)) && (utrka(1)==poredak(2)||utrka(2)==poredak(2)||utrka(3)==poredak(2)) && (utrka(1)==poredak(3)||utrka(2)==poredak(3)||utrka(3)==poredak(3))) trifecta_box = trifecta_box + 1; end end

Pa=trifecta/N Pb=trifecta_box/N

Rezultat simulacije :
Pa=0,00071 Pb =0.00451 Obrazlozenje : Radio sam na nesto manjem broju uzoraka i dobijeni rezultat se malo razlikuje od analitickog , za prepostavit je da bi se sa povecanem kombinacjja priblizio analitickom rijesenju.

2. Kontejner sadri 1000 elektronickih uredjaja, od kojih su 940 ispravni. Prilikom testiranja uredjaja, nasumice se bira 100 uredjaja i provjerava se koliko ima ispravnih i neispravnih uredjaja. Koritenjem programskog alata Octave sa vecim brojem simulacija odrediti vjerovatnocu da je njih 95 ili vie ispravno. Pretpostaviti da se svaki put bira nasumice razlicita skupina od 100 uredjaja iz kontejnera. Uporediti dobijenu vrijednost sa analiticki dobijenom vjerovatnocom. Obrazloiti.

Analiticko rijesenje : U=1000 I=940 p= =1000 =0.94


940

- imamo ukupno uredjaja -imamo ispravnih uredjaja -vjerovatnoca da ce se izvuc ispravan uredjaj

-Biramo nasumicno grupe od 100 uredjaja, vjerovanoca p, je vjerovatnoca da ce se njih 95 ili vise izvuci ispravno, koju racunamo po sljedecem izrazu:

P[k 95]=

100 100 =95 95

(1 )100 =0.44

-Rijesenje programski : N=50000; vektor = 1:1000; brojac=0; for i=1:940 vektor(i)=1; end for i=941:1000 vektor(i)=0; end for i=1:N temp=randperm(1000); temp2=temp(1:100); for j=1:100 izvuceni(j)=vektor(temp2(j)); end suma=sum(izvuceni); if suma>=95 brojac=brojac + 1; end end P=brojac/N

Rezultat simulacije :
Za N=50000

P=0,4304
Za N=75000

P=0.4391 Obrazlozenje : I ovdje se uocava razlika izmedju analiticki dobijenog rijesenja I rezultata dobivenog simulacijom , povecavanjem broja uzoraka nase rijesenje simulacije se priblizava analitickom rijesenju .

You might also like